More Than Just Crayons and Paper
When kids sit down with these printables, they are actively engaging with history. Coloring a detailed Mariachi band or a beautiful Frida Kahlo portrait naturally sparks curiosity. Suddenly, they're asking questions about the music, the traditional clothing, and the inspiring people who shaped society. It seamlessly transforms a simple afternoon activity into an organic learning experience about Latin American history and culture.

Bringing Latin American Art to Life
The sheer variety of National Hispanic Heritage Month printables available today is absolutely staggering. From intricate Aztec and Mayan patterns to joyful Día de los Muertos sugar skulls, the artwork is specifically designed to inspire creativity while honoring deep roots. You can easily find everything from maps of Spanish-speaking countries to inspiring quotes from famous Hispanic leaders.
